摘要
为了研究锐钛矿型纳米TiO2光催化活性,本文以钛酸四丁酯为原料,利用溶胶—凝胶法制备了纯锐钛矿型TiO2纳米粉体及不同金属离子掺杂的锐钛矿型TiO2纳米粉体,采用XRD、Raman光谱对纳米TiO2进行了表征,考察了不同金属离子掺杂对TiO2光催化降解甲基橙活性的影响。结果表明:不同离子掺杂后的TiO2与纯TiO2相比,拉曼谱峰强度降低,平均粒径变小,光催化活性提高。
In order to study the anatase nanometer TiO2 photocatalytic activity,the anatase TiO2 and different doped metal ion of nanometer anatase TiO2 powder were prepared with sol-gel using Ti(OC4H9)4 as raw materials. The TiO2 nanoparticles were characterized by XRD,Raman spectra,effects,different ions doping on TiO2 photocatalytic degradation of methyl orange activity results show that compared with pure TiO2 metal ions doped TiO2 has smaller particle size,decreased Raman spectrum peak intensity and improved the photocatalytic activity.
